Virtual Prince William Virtual Withdraw Policy

VPW will follow the county withdraw/drop course policy: Regulation 661.04-5, "Reporting/Grading Procedures, Procedures for Recording Grades of Students Who Drop a Class During the School Year – Grades Nine-12."

Since VPW courses are completed in a semester, VPW will adhere to the following semester regulations:

Fall and Spring Term Withdraw Policies

  1. Students who drop a VPW course before the end of the first four weeks of the course shall not have the attempt recorded on their transcript.
  2. Students who drop a VPW course after the first four weeks but before the end of the first semester shall receive no credit and a notation shall be made on the student's transcript indicating withdraw failing or withdraw passing.
  3. Students who drop a VPW course after the first semester of the course shall receive no credit and a failing grade for the course.
  4. The principal (or designee) may, in extenuating circumstances relating to a student's health or well-being, make an exception to this regulation.

Summer Withdraw Policies

  1. Students who withdraw prior to the start of the Summer term or on the first day of the term will receive a full refund and no penalty for taking the course. There will be NO refunds after the first day of the summer term.
  2. Students who withdraw during the first week of the summer term will not be penalized on their transcript for taking the course.
  3. Students who withdraw during weeks 2 and 3 will receive a WF or WP on their transcripts and will not receive a credit for the course.
  4. Students who withdraw during weeks 4-6 will receive an automatic F and will not receive credit for the course.
